Protests in Shopian after army beats youth

Protests in Shopian after army beats youth

Srinagar :Protests erupted Wednesday in Ahgam, Shopian after government allegedly beat up three youths without any provocation. Reports said that scores of people took to streets against the army for beating up three youth .
